Seasoned Aster Scaber Greens (Chwinamul Muchim)
A fragrant seasoned side dish of aster scaber greens, blanched until vivid green and tossed in a gochujang dressing. A touch of salt in the boiling water keeps the color bright, and sesame oil and toasted sesame add a nutty finish.

Ingredients
Main
- Aster scaber greens (chwinamul)1 bunch (about 200g)
- Green onion1/2 stalk
- Salt (for blanching)A pinch
Sauce & Seasoning
- Gochujang (Korean chili paste)1 tbsp
- Sesame oil1 tbsp
- Minced garlic1/2 tbsp
- Oligosaccharide syrup1/2 tbsp
- Toasted sesame seeds1 tbsp
Directions
- 1

Trim the aster scaber greens and rinse them clean.
- 2

Blanch the greens in boiling water. Adding a little salt to the water keeps them a bright green.
- 3

Blanch quickly. Over-blanching turns the color yellowish, so work fast.
- 4

Rinse the bright-green blanched greens quickly in cold water.
- 5

Squeeze out the water firmly by hand and place in a bowl. After blanching and squeezing, the volume shrinks noticeably.
- 6

Cut the blanched greens in half into bite-size pieces and thinly slice the green onion.
- 7

Now the key dressing: mix 1 tbsp gochujang, 1 tbsp sesame oil, 1/2 tbsp sesame seeds and 1/2 tbsp oligosaccharide syrup.
- 8

In a deep bowl, add the greens, green onion, 1/2 tbsp minced garlic, 1/2 tbsp sesame seeds and the prepared dressing.
- 9

Toss gently by hand to coat. If it tastes bland at this point, add a little salt to adjust the seasoning.
- 10

Transfer to a serving plate and finish with a sprinkle of toasted sesame seeds.
